7. Westbeth

Westbeth Artists Housing in NYC is the world's largest artists’ community. A home to the arts, it offers affordable artist housing and studios, exhibitions, performances, classes, workshops, and a celebrated flea market. Westbeth also co-sponsors events with the Whitney Museum, PEN America, OpenHouseNY, and other cultural organizations.
